It’s labelled as an EP on itunes but it’s actually one 10min track. That said it’s not really a 10 min song, it’s actually different songs with the same vocalist - no idea who this is, it’s a reggae guest artist that hadn’t been used on any SAULT song previously afaik.

First track (or section if you will) is a funk-reggae fusion, second one is a piano ballad that has some cool 70’s aor prog choir arrangements towards the end, third segment is a spoken word interlude, fourth one is a soulful chill tune.

I think it could count as an EP, wish it was actually spliced into 4 tracks instead of a single one. Specially because I’m not a fan of spoken word segments and will probably find myself skipping that section.
